I am working with OEM version 1.5 on Windows NT and connecting to an 8.0.4 Oracle database. The repository did not exist so the OEM creates it on startup. No problem with that part. I have worked with OEM 1.2 and 1.3 before.

It then starts a wizard that wants to discover other databases. I cancel that.
When I try to look at databases in the OEM window, it shows none. Not even the database containing the repository I have just connected to.

My Questions:
Does this new version of OEM still use the topology.ora file that previous versions used? The install did not create a 'Network Topology Generator' icon. I will have to double check the CD to see if the Network Management stuff is separate.

Why is the database I am connected to not showup in OEM's list of databases? Received on Thu Aug 27 1998 - 08:20:45 CDT
